I made a pumpkin pinata tonight for DD's girl scout party tomorrow.

I used water & flour as the paste.. id found directions online, did several layers of paste & paper

now its decorated . but not completely dry..

it feels umm.. smooshy

Im scared it wont be stiff in the morning & when i pop the balloon to fill it , it'll cave in


I should have done this days ago..i always do stuff last minute
post #2 of 5
This happened to me last year.I set it in front of a fan overnight(I did get up to turn it once) and it dried okay
post #3 of 5
I've used a hair dryer to dry paper mache (just be careful not to get too close).
